What is it?
The Qigong class is based on Eastern teachings of body meridians – these are energy channels in our body through which Qi, or life energy, flows. Specifically, we work with the 12 meridians of the Taoist tradition, each of which is connected to a specific organ and has its own specific functions. In Asia it is known – good health and a balanced mind start with the nature of Qi movement - if Qi flows harmoniously in the meridians, a person is healthy, active and happy; but if Qi movement is obstructed for some reason, it can be felt in one's mind and body as imbalance – e.g. fatigue, weak immunity, pains, a tense mind.
The class takes place at a calm pace and consists of various movement exercises, static stretching postures and massage, to support the harmonious movement of Qi in the body. On a physical level, the exercises help to open the joints and spine, improve blood and lymphatic circulation, and calm the mind. We finish the class with a pleasant relaxation.
